Abstract: This report describes how techniques from the AI community could be leveraged to provide several of the advanced process management capabilities envisioned by the workflow community. The report focuses on the role that AI technologies can play in the construction of workflow engines that manage complex processes, while remaining robust, reactive, and adaptive in the face of both environmental and tasking changes.
